Transaction 83d3f2fb12589d42b3ce68225d1aa576d30dde26567e39c3284f7d8b616b2215
1 Input
1 Output
-
83d3f2fb12589d42b3ce68225d1aa576d30dde26567e39c3284f7d8b616b2215:0
- value
- 2539837
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8434e8cfc4d26d348c147ed6e64e97511e7e0a87 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D43aXtcxd873XTjspECUgVbf31r4agWTg